The Zorza Festival is a unique cultural event created by Dawid Podsiadło, combining music with other artistic disciplines such as visual art, literature, and design. The festival’s idea is to go beyond the confines of a traditional concert to create a space brimming with innovation and artistic experiences.
Sunset Square is one of the Tricity’s most intriguing musical offerings – a festival that combines club sounds with a seaside landscape. In 2025, the event will return to Gdynia, thrilling audiences for two exciting evenings – August 15 and 16, 2025. The festival venue will be the iconic Kościuszko Square, situated right on the seafront, overlooking the setting sun and passing ships – the perfect setting for music and a good time.

Mystic Festival is one of the most important music festivals in Poland, which brings together fans of heavy sounds from all over the world. In 2025, the festival will last from 4 to 7 June at the Gdańsk Shipyard, continuing the tradition of organizing the event in an original post-industrial space.
The origins of Mystic Festival date back to 1999, when an event dedicated to metal music lovers was organized for the first time. Over the years, such music legends as Iron Maiden, Judas Priest, Slayer, Bruce Dickinson, Slipknot, King Diamond, Nightwish and Celtic Frost have performed on the festival stages. After editions in various cities in Poland, in 2019 the event returned to the map of music events, finding its place in the unique space of the Gdańsk Shipyard.
